Abstract:
Aggregatibacter aphrophilus(A.aphrophilus)is a normal bacterial flora in the oropharynx,and rarely causes lumbar spine infection in clinical practice.As fastidious bacteria,A.aphrophilus has high nutritional requirements,thus is difficult to be cultured and identified,and prone to be missed in detection.A.aphrophilus was detected from the blood culture of a patient with lumbar spine infection in a hospital.The anti-infection treat-ment based on detection results for the patient was effective after adjusting antimicrobials.This paper reports a rare case of A.aphrophilus lumbar spine infection with literature reviews.
